Opening a Company in Hong Kong A Comprehensive Analysis of Registration Costs and Related Fees

Starting a business in Hong Kong is an attractive option for entrepreneurs around the world, thanks to its robust infrastructure, strategic location, and favorable business environment. However, one of the most common concerns for those considering setting up shop in Hong Kong is understanding the costs involved. This article aims to provide a detailed breakdown of the expenses associated with opening a company in Hong Kong, including registration fees and other related costs.

Cost of Setting Up a Hong Kong Company Comprehensive Analysis of Registration Fees and Related Costs

The process of registering a company in Hong Kong begins with choosing the right structure for your business. The most common type of company is the Limited Liability Company LLC, which offers limited liability protection to its shareholders. To register such a company, you will need to pay the Companies Registry fee, which currently stands at HKD 1,720 approximately USD 220. This fee covers the initial incorporation process and includes the issuance of your company's Certificate of Incorporation.

In addition to the registration fee, there are other costs that must be considered. One of these is the annual government fee, which is HKD 255 approximately USD 33 per year. This fee is mandatory for maintaining your company’s active status with the Companies Registry. It is important to note that failure to pay this fee on time can result in penalties or even the dissolution of your company.

Another significant cost is professional assistance. Many entrepreneurs opt to hire a local agent or consultant to handle the registration process. These professionals can guide you through the legal requirements, ensure compliance with regulations, and streamline the application process. The cost of hiring such services can vary significantly depending on the complexity of your business setup and the reputation of the service provider. Typically, the fee ranges from HKD 5,000 to HKD 20,000 USD 640 to USD 2,560.

Accounting and auditing services are also essential for maintaining your company’s financial health. While not required immediately upon incorporation, these services become necessary once your company begins operations. The cost of accounting services can range from HKD 10,000 to HKD 50,000 USD 1,280 to USD 6,400 annually, depending on the size and nature of your business. Similarly, auditing services can cost between HKD 15,000 and HKD 80,000 USD 1,920 to USD 10,240 annually.

For businesses that require a physical office space, rental costs must also be factored into the overall budget. Office rentals in Hong Kong are among the highest in the world, with prices varying greatly based on location and size. Central Hong Kong, for instance, is known for its high-end commercial real estate, where monthly rents can exceed HKD 100 per square foot. In contrast, areas further from the city center may offer more affordable options, with monthly rents starting at around HKD 30 per square foot.

Another consideration is the cost of employee salaries and benefits. Hong Kong has a competitive labor market, and attracting skilled workers often requires offering competitive compensation packages. Salaries can vary widely depending on the industry and level of expertise required. For example, entry-level positions in finance or technology may start at HKD 15,000 per month USD 1,920, while senior management roles can command salaries upwards of HKD 100,000 per month USD 12,800.

Insurance is another critical expense for businesses operating in Hong Kong. Depending on the nature of your business, you may need to purchase various types of insurance, including general liability, property insurance, and professional indemnity insurance. The cost of these policies can range from HKD 5,000 to HKD 50,000 USD 640 to USD 6,400 annually, depending on the coverage and the risk profile of your business.

Finally, it is worth mentioning the importance of understanding tax obligations. Hong Kong operates a territorial tax system, meaning that only income generated within Hong Kong is subject to taxation. The standard corporate tax rate is 16.5%, but there are various deductions and exemptions available to reduce taxable income. Consulting with a tax advisor is highly recommended to ensure compliance and optimize your tax strategy.
